Adelaila
ad-eh-LAY-lah
Adelaila is a girl’s name of Germanic origin, meaning “Adelaila is a combination of Germanic 'Adel' meaning 'noble' and 'Laila' of Arabic origin meaning 'night'.”. It currently ranks #15271 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2024.

The Story of Adelaila
This name combines the starlight of Arabic lore with the ancient strength of Germanic nobility.
Adelaila is a contemporary creation, artfully blending the Germanic root 'Adel,' meaning 'noble,' with the Arabic 'Laila,' signifying 'night.' This fusion creates a name that is both grounded and ethereal.
